About Fortune of Flint: Back for Gold Slot

The first Fortune of Flint shipped late last year with a 15,000x ceiling and the same crew of skulls and Captain Flint mugging from a cartoon pirate ship. Back for Gold is the follow-up, and the most obvious change is one a returning player will notice immediately: the top end has been cut to 5,000x. In exchange, Gamebeat folded in a four-tier in-game jackpot ladder (Mini, Minor, Major, Mega) plus a Mystery Jackpot coin that pays a randomised amount when it lands. Whether that trade reads as a downgrade or a wider hit distribution depends on how often you actually chase max wins.

The reels sit on a weather-beaten ship deck against a cloudy sky, with Captain Flint himself, pistol cocked and grinning, painted onto the Wild banner that runs the full height of a reel. When a Wild lands it expands to cover the whole column and brings a multiplier between x2 and x10. The interaction worth knowing: if two expanding Wilds land and both touch the same winning line, their multipliers stack on that win rather than picking the higher of the two. A x4 and a x9 on the same payline becomes x36, not x9.

Three Treasure Map scatters award 10 free spins, four give 15, and five hand over 25. The bonus is where the skull modifiers earn their keep. Add Skulls drop a flat coin value onto the board, Multiply Skulls multiply whatever coins are present, and both have Sticky variants that lock in place and keep compounding every remaining spin. Land a Sticky Multiply early and the next ten or fifteen spins all run through it.

The Golden Spot side-bonus is a short Hold and Win respin round triggered by Golden Spot symbols on specific reel positions. You get three respins, and every new spot that lands resets the counter back to three. It is where the four jackpot coins live, so a full-board fill on the Mega tier is the 1,000x payout your bet sheet keeps quietly referring to.

There is no buy bonus on this title. The feature menu has the option greyed out, so scatters and Golden Spots are the only routes in. For a sequel that trimmed the volatility ceiling, the layered skull-modifier interactions during free spins are doing most of the heavy lifting now.
